Output 84dca892c9527baccdadbffc0d92a538ae0bfdbcd22dfedc4ce7846c37fcf7bf:5

value
314416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d5923d4a1151c989c39d6a02737695e5e5e7fed OP_EQUAL
address
3LQoERSaj7Vcsv1Fj58L8kcTUvL6dDmhGx
transaction
84dca892c9527baccdadbffc0d92a538ae0bfdbcd22dfedc4ce7846c37fcf7bf
confirmations
138736
spent
true